"Orientalsk paladsinteriør med et selskab, der underholdes af dansere" (Oriental Palace Interior with a Company Entertained by Dancers) is a 1668 etching by Danish artist Augustin John. The print, housed in SMK - Statens Museum for Kunst, depicts a bustling scene with European figures in a palatial setting. Set against an arched backdrop, the scene unfolds with a group of men in richly detailed clothing seated on a floor, watching dancers perform while others look on from the upper balconies. John's masterful use of detail and light in this artwork creates a realistic and engaging depiction of a lavish interior scene from the 17th century. The etching's depiction of a diverse group of characters engaging in a festive gathering offers a glimpse into the social life and cultural exchange during the 17th century.
